    Hi folks. Another workaround is : 1 - Group the welded curves to avoid damaging them with additional geometries. 2 - Add an edge between the two points where you want to attach a dimension line. 3 - Add the dimension using either the edge or its endpoint. 4 - Delete the edge, keeping only the dimension. 5 - If required, explode the group. Just ideas.

    Last night I converted about 300 groups into 1 component in 1 swell foop. It also showed I had about a dozen almost identical groups with a common very minor change in them, that did not convert, as expected, but they would be hard to find otherwise. I did this by selecting ALL, and converting. After the conversion to a single comp, only those unique groups that did not convert remained highlighted. Note: it is not necessary to highlight any of the multiple groups, except the single any one group to effect the conversion. All same groups in the model will convert. I have not tried testing with layered and visible same groups yet, but I will. Now I will try to figure how to convert those similar groups into the same single comp. I think I know how, but I haven't figured out the correct sequence yet. (edit added) I just noticed that my old 43mb+ file is down to 31mb, and I'm not done converting yet. And it saves faster too. Bonus.

    Hi Larry, hi folks. In supplement, the Text Tool will default to these informations: line: length. face: area. endpoint: coordinates in the form X,Y,Z. One trick: you can switch units between use. For example, if you use the Text Tool on a face, you will get the area in square feet. Then, switch to meters and you can add another text entity with the surface in square meters. Just ideas.
